Jian Pan is a scholar working on Molecular Biology, Cancer Research and Oncology. According to data from OpenAlex, Jian Pan has authored 131 papers receiving a total of 2.2k indexed citations (citations by other indexed papers that have themselves been cited), including 73 papers in Molecular Biology, 26 papers in Cancer Research and 23 papers in Oncology. Recurrent topics in Jian Pan’s work include Ubiquitin and proteasome pathways (18 papers), Protein Degradation and Inhibitors (13 papers) and Sepsis Diagnosis and Treatment (10 papers). Jian Pan is often cited by papers focused on Ubiquitin and proteasome pathways (18 papers), Protein Degradation and Inhibitors (13 papers) and Sepsis Diagnosis and Treatment (10 papers). Jian Pan collaborates with scholars based in China, United States and Singapore. Jian Pan's co-authors include Yanhong Li, Xing Feng, Zhuan Zhou, Zhenjiang Bai, Yuliang Ran, Jian Ni, Lichao Sun, Jian Wang, Fang Fang and Jian Wang and has published in prestigious journals such as Journal of the American Chemical Society, Journal of Biological Chemistry and Blood.
